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: FSCLMPMS

Package: National Online Information Sharing

Routine: FSCLMPMS


Information

FSCLMPMS ;SLC/STAFF-NOIS List Manager Protocol Modify Save ;1/13/98 12:55

Source Information

Source file <FSCLMPMS.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
National Online Information Sharing 4 BAD^FSCLDS  BUILD^FSCLDU  (ENTRY,HEADER)^FSCLMM  QDESC^FSCLMPMQ  
VA FileMan 2 ^DIE  ^DIR  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
National Online Information Sharing 1 FSCLMPM  

Entry Points

Name Comments DBIA/ICR reference
STUFF ; from FSCLMPM
; common update for editing
; not scoped
SAVE(QDESC,OK) ;
STORE(ZERO,DESC,QDESC,QDEF) ;

External References

Name Field # of Occurrence
^DIE STORE+7
^DIR SAVE+9
BAD^FSCLDS STORE+2, STORE+21, STORE+22
BUILD^FSCLDU STORE+22
ENTRY^FSCLMM STUFF+8
HEADER^FSCLMM STUFF+8
QDESC^FSCLMPMQ STUFF+3

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"The new definition will be:"
  • Line Location: SAVE+2
Function Call: WRITE
  • Prompt: !,QDESC(LINE)
  • Line Location: SAVE+3
Routine Call
  • DIE
  • Line Location:
    • STORE+7
Routine Call
  • DIR
  • Line Location:
    • SAVE+9

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^FSC("LIST" - [#7107.1] STUFF+7, STORE+1, STORE+2, STORE+4, STORE+9!, STORE+10*, STORE+11*, STORE+13!, STORE+14*, STORE+15*
, STORE+17!, STORE+18*, STORE+19*, STORE+20
^XTMP("FSC LIST DEF" STORE+21, STORE+23

Label References

Name Line Occurrences
SAVE STUFF+4
STORE STUFF+6

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
CNT STORE+1~, STORE+10*, STORE+11, STORE+14*, STORE+15, STORE+18*, STORE+19
DA STORE+1~, STORE+4*
DESC STUFF+6, STORE~, STORE+8
DESC( STORE+10
DIC STORE+1~, STORE+4*
DIE STORE+1~, STORE+4*
DIR SAVE+1~!, SAVE+9!
DIR("?" SAVE+5*, SAVE+6*, SAVE+7*
DIR("??" SAVE+8*
DIR("A" SAVE+4*
DIR("B" SAVE+4*
DIR(0 SAVE+4*
DR STORE+1~, STORE+4*, STORE+5*, STORE+6*, STORE+7
DT STORE+11, STORE+15
>> FSCLNAME STUFF+7*
>> FSCLNUM STUFF+7, STORE+1, STORE+2, STORE+4, STORE+9, STORE+10, STORE+11, STORE+13, STORE+14, STORE+15
, STORE+17, STORE+18, STORE+19, STORE+20, STORE+21, STORE+22, STORE+23
>> FSCQEDIT STORE+1*
LINE SAVE+1~, SAVE+3*, STORE+1~, STORE+10*, STORE+14*, STORE+18*
LIST0 STORE+1~, STORE+4*, STORE+5, STORE+6
>> NEWDEF STUFF+3, STUFF+6
OK STUFF+4, STUFF+5, SAVE~, SAVE+10*, SAVE+11*, STORE+1~, STORE+22
QDEF STORE~, STORE+16
QDEF( STORE+18
QDESC STUFF+3, STUFF+4, STUFF+6, SAVE~, STORE~, STORE+12
QDESC( SAVE+3, STORE+14
U STUFF+7, STORE+1, STORE+5, STORE+6, STORE+11, STORE+15, STORE+19
X SAVE+1~
Y SAVE+1~, SAVE+10
ZERO STORE~, STORE+3, STORE+5, STORE+6
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All